Accelerated Testing is testing under elevated stress conditions to obtain long-term reliability insight within practical development timelines - It is a core method in advanced semiconductor engineering programs.
What Is Accelerated Testing?
- Definition: testing under elevated stress conditions to obtain long-term reliability insight within practical development timelines.
- Core Mechanism: Physics-based acceleration increases failure-event rates so lifetime behavior can be inferred sooner.
- Operational Scope: It is applied in semiconductor design, verification, test, and qualification workflows to improve robustness, signoff confidence, and long-term product quality outcomes.
- Failure Modes: Invalid acceleration models can produce misleading lifetime projections and wrong design decisions.

How It Is Used in Practice
- Method Selection: Choose approaches by failure risk, verification coverage, and implementation complexity.
- Calibration: Select stress conditions that preserve dominant failure mechanisms and verify model fit with empirical data.
- Validation: Track corner pass rates, silicon correlation, and objective metrics through recurring controlled evaluations.
